Return On Investment Template Brad Ryan, April 12, 2025 A return on investment template provides a structured framework for calculating the profitability of an investment. For instance, a business might use it to assess the potential gains from a new marketing campaign, projecting revenues against the costs involved. Proper financial modeling is essential. Effective investment analysis hinges on accurately measuring returns. Utilizing a standardized format allows for consistent evaluation and comparison across diverse projects and asset classes. This fosters informed decision-making, mitigates risk, and ultimately, maximizes potential financial gain. This analytical approach has evolved alongside advancements in accounting and investment management principles. The benefit of using a template is to gain a clear picture of project profitability.
